It's commonplace for backs to be missing on early TV's. Often it was suggested to allow for better cooling. I found some nice selections of perforated sheet metal on eBay that worked very well to make backs for two Admiral TV's. I've seen them made from sheets of Masonite too, but it requires more work to make the cooling holes/slats. I agree that your RCA likely used masonite, although metal was used on the earlier models. The worst choice is peg-board in my opinion. It always looks cheesy.
